JEFF JARRETT TO RETURN TO NEW JAPAN PRO WRESTLING FOR OCT. 13’S “KING OF PRO-WRESTLING” EVENT IN TOKYO

NASHVILLE – Jeff Jarrett, whose visit to New Japan Pro Wrestling ostensibly to sign a partnership between that promotion and the Jarrett-helmed Global Force Wrestling at the G1 Climax event only to see the legendary wrestler/promoter join the “Bullet Club,” will make his return to NJPW for “King of Pro-Wrestling” on Oct. 13,

Jarrett appeared at the G1 show at the Seibu Dome in August at the invitation of Naoki Sugabayashi, chairman of the board of NJPW. After signing the agreement to exchange talent and co-promote some major events, Jarrett appeared later during the event after a match between IWGP heavyweight champion A.J. Styles and Tanahashi. With Styles and the rest of the Bullet Club administering a post-match beatdown to the Japanese star, Jarrett looked as though he was breaking up the melee. But, he pulled out a guitar with the words “Bullet Club” on the back and proceeded to smash it over Tanahashi’s head and reveal his allegiance to the hottest faction in pro wrestling.

“It was a business trip, and I took care of a lot of business,” Jarrett said. “Not only did I seal a deal for Global Force Wrestling with the hottest promotion in the Eastern Hemisphere, but I aligned with the biggest thing going in this business.

“It’s important for GFW fans to see us get involved with the best talent in the world. The Bullet Club certainly qualifies, and I’m looking forward to what we have in store for The King of Pro-Wrestling show.”

Styles will defend the IWGP title against Tanahashi in the main event. The rest of the Bullet Club will be in action as well, including IWGP tag team champions Karl Anderson and Doc Gallows.

GFW announced its partnership with NJPW on June 23, and plans already are in the works for the first co-promoted event.
